Research day care Options
Prior to you pick a daycare for your dog, it's important to investigate your options extensively. Begin by asking pals, household, or your veterinarian for referrals.
Try to find facilities that focus on safety and security and have favorable testimonials from other dog owners. Inspect their websites for info on their personnel's credentials, the size of play areas, and the proportion of staff to pet dogs.
It's also vital to find out what tasks they supply and exactly how they deal with habits problems. Ensure the day care has correct licenses and insurance.
Ultimately, think about the location and hours to ensure they're convenient for your schedule. Taking time to vet your choices will certainly help ensure your pet has a risk-free and delightful experience.
Schedule a Go to
Once you have actually limited your day care options, it's time to arrange a browse through. This action is vital for both you and your pet.
Throughout the browse through, pay attention to the personnel's communications with the pet dogs and how they manage the setting. Observe just how tidy and risk-free the center is, and check if there's enough area for your pet dog to play.
Do not wait to ask inquiries about their policies, tasks, and emergency procedures. Bring your pet along ideally, so you can assess their convenience degree in the new environments.
A visit allows you to see if the day care straightens with your expectations and offers you comfort before your dog's very first day.

Prepare Your Pet's Fundamentals
As you plan for your dog's day care adventure, collecting their basics is crucial to guarantee they have actually a comfortable and satisfying experience.
Begin by packing a well-fitting collar with an ID tag that includes your call information. Next, consist of a favored plaything or blanket to offer comfort and knowledge.
Do not fail to remember to pack adequate food throughout of their stay, along with any special nutritional directions. If your pet takes medicine, make certain to consist of those, identified clearly with dosage instructions.
Finally, take into consideration bringing a water bottle or bowl for hydration. Having these fundamentals ready will certainly aid your pet feel protected and looked after while they're away from home.
Socialize Your Pet Ahead Of Time
Prior to your pet steps into daycare, it's vital to mingle them to guarantee they really feel comfy and certain around other pets and individuals.
Begin by subjecting your dog to different atmospheres, like parks or pet-friendly stores. Prepare playdates with various other pet dogs to help them learn ideal habits and borders.
Go to pup courses or training sessions, where they can interact with various other pet dogs in a regulated setting. Encourage positive experiences by satisfying etiquette with treats and appreciation.
Likewise, slowly present them to different noises, sights, and smells they'll come across at daycare. This way, they won't feel overwhelmed on their first day.
Establish a Routine
Developing a routine for your dog can substantially ease their shift into daycare. Uniformity is vital, so attempt to keep feeding, walking, and playtime routines comparable to what they'll experience at day care.
Begin by getting up at the same time each day and feeding them at normal periods. Include daily strolls and play sessions to help them expend energy and end up being accustomed to structured activities.
This predictability will certainly make your pet feel even more safe and lower stress and anxiety when they start daycare. You might likewise intend to present new playthings or tasks that are available at the day care, making the experience much less intimidating.

Screen Your Pet dog's Actions
While your pet dog is at day care, keeping an eye on their behavior can offer valuable insights into exactly how they're adapting to their new environment. Take notice of their interactions with various other canines and personnel. Are they playing gladly or appear taken out?
Notice any type of indications of stress, like extreme barking, pacing, or hiding. These habits can indicate how comfortable they feel in this new setting.
After daycare, look for indications of fatigue or enjoyment, which can assist you evaluate their experience. If you see any kind of worrying actions, interact with the daycare staff; they can supply responses and modifications to aid your pet clear up in far better.
Observing these behaviors will certainly aid you recognize your canine's needs and make sure a smoother change.
